An industry insider has revealed the hidden meaning in ' emotional statement amid the breakdown of The Kyle and Jackie O Show.
Sandilands broke his silence on Tuesday, claiming he has been 'muzzled' by his employers, Australian Radio Network, and barred from contacting his long-time co-host or speaking with colleagues.
Entertainment reporter Peter Ford pointed out some very telling comments in the content of the bombshell statement.
'He's clearly saying, let me get back on air - I think he's accepted that he and Jackie O are not going to be a team ever again,' Ford told 2GB's Clinton Maynard.
'And if you know much about Kyle, he's like a real radio animal, he needs to be on the radio in the same way that Dracula needs blood.'
Ford added: 'He wants to be on the radio and I think he will be again in the future. You're not going to keep him away.'

The top-rating KIIS FM breakfast host, 54, addressed listeners directly on Tuesday after he was suspended from The Kyle and Jackie O Show and .
Henderson's $100 million contract was also terminated after she told executives she 'cannot continue to work with Mr Kyle Sandilands' after the fallout.
'I want to speak directly to my listeners, my colleagues and the public about what has been happening,' Sandilands began in his statement.

'On 20 February, I had an argument with Jackie on air about something that had been bothering me for a while. I said things I wish I had said differently.'
Sandilands went on to say that he privately apologised to Henderson after the feud and deeply regretted hurting his long-time co-host's feelings.
'That same evening, I sent Jackie a message telling her I was sorry for anything I said that didn't go down well, that I love her and care for her, and that I could have handled it better. I meant every word of that, and I still do,' he continued.
'Jackie and I have worked together for over 25 years. She is one of the most important people in my life. The idea that our partnership could end like this is devastating to me.'
The shock jock went on to claim ARN had imposed some strict conditions amid the fallout.

ARN provided written notice to Sandilands stating it considers his behaviour during the show on February 20 to be 'an act of serious misconduct which is in breach of ARN's service agreement with Quasar Media.'
Kyle was suspended and given 14 days to 'remedy' the breach, or else he faces termination.
